Legal Research Podcasts

28 May 08 - 17:16

As long as the Law Library is closed for a few days, why not spend some time at home refreshing your research skills?  The Suffolke University Law School Legal Practice Skills Program has released a nineteen-part series, "Transitioning from One-L to Summer Legal Work."  Presented by a nationwide group of legal research and writing instructors, the series covers topics ranging from "Cost Effective Legal Research Skills" to "Successfully Navigating the Summer Associate Social Scene."
